Pressure relief valve leaking water

Hi,
Water leaking from pressure relief valve fited on water tank. It is on could pip water coming in the tank 6 par. around 10 months a go I changed the pressure valve (cold water) after stop leaking for 3 months the next time I changed the peruser valve with (Caleffi - 22mm Inlet Control Multibloc Valve) after 3 mounts start again leaking water.

I would be appreciate if someone give me some advice.

2 Answers from MyBuilder Plumbers

Best Answer

Hi
Probable cause can be one of the following
Pressure reducing valve, in this case you need to replace multifunction valve as it's a built in component
Or cold water expansion vessel has ruptured which also needs replacing

If it has happened before, then i would suspect either your white expansion vessel needs recharged (usually to about 3 bar) or it has ruptured inside and would need replaced
